do you have an aftermarket ignition system?

lookin for a new aftermarket ignition. i know i asked in the tech forum, but maybe it would be better here since you other luders may have more suggestions.

just to let you know, i'm very leery about MSD, considering i just fried one in 3 days and had to revert to stock.

the motor is also boosted to 5 psi, so i do need an aftermarket setup for safety sake.
